Honey BBQ Chicken Mac & Cheese

Honey BBQ Chicken Mac & Cheese: A Protein-Packed Delight

This Honey BBQ Chicken Mac & Cheese delivers a smoky-sweet flavor fusion with a protein-packed punch that is sure to please everyone.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Resting Time 10 minutes
Total Time 1 hour
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 480

Ingredients
  

For the Cheese Sauce
  • 1 cup Fat-Free Cottage Cheese Substitute with Greek yogurt for a similarly smooth texture.
  • 4 oz Light Cream Cheese Opt for reduced-fat if preferred.
  • 1 cup Reduced Fat Cheddar Cheese Feel free to use any favorite melting cheese.
  • 1 cup Semi-Skimmed Milk (2%) Almond milk makes a great dairy-free alternative.
  • 1 tsp Garlic Powder Fresh minced garlic adds an extra punch.
  • 1 tsp Paprika Smoked paprika can be used for more flavor.
  • 1 tsp Salt Using Kosher salt allows for controlled seasoning.
  • 1 tbsp Mustard Dijon mustard is an excellent substitute.
For the Chicken
  • 1 lb Diced Chicken Breasts (or Turkey) Replace with grilled tofu for vegetarian.
  • 2 tbsp Honey Maple syrup is a vegan substitute.
  • 1 tsp Ground Ginger Fresh ginger can intensify flavor.
  • 1 tsp Onion Powder Sautéed fresh onion adds depth.
  • 1/2 cup Reduced BBQ Sauce Look for low-sodium varieties.
For the Pasta
  • 2 cups Pasta (Elbow Macaroni) Substitute with any pasta type you enjoy.
  • 1 tsp Black Pepper White pepper provides a milder choice.
  • as needed Low-Calorie Cooking Spray Olive oil is a healthier alternative.
For Garnishing
  • 2 tbsp Parsley Chives work beautifully as an alternative.

Equipment

  • blender
  • Saucepan
  • skillet
  • large pot
  • Air fryer

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Prepare the BBQ Chicken: Season diced chicken with garlic powder, onion powder, ground ginger, salt, and black pepper. Cook at 350°F for 10-12 minutes or sauté for 6-8 minutes until cooked through. Coat with honey and reduced BBQ sauce, allowing it to caramelize slightly.
  2. Cook the Pasta: Bring salted water to a boil, add elbow macaroni and cook until al dente (8-10 minutes). Reserve a cup of pasta water, then drain and set aside.
  3. Make the Cheese Sauce: In a blender, combine cottage cheese, cream cheese, cheddar cheese, milk, garlic powder, paprika, and mustard. Blend until smooth. Heat in a saucepan for 5-7 minutes, stirring until thickened, adding reserved pasta water if needed.
  4. Combine and Serve: In a mixing bowl, combine the pasta with the cheese sauce, fold in the honey BBQ chicken, and let sit for 10 minutes. Serve garnished with parsley.

Notes

Customize by adding fresh greens or different cheeses. Store cheese sauce and chicken separately from pasta for meal prep.
